A lot of women out there wonder why men lie so much. You must have heard jokes about it and even made a couple yourself. However, do you really know why they lie so often about their whereabouts, what they were doing and who they were with? Even though most men just laugh it off, most women are completely baffled when it comes to this. However, there are actual reasons behind why men lie and if you want to confront them better, then you need to understand these reasons first and foremost. Read on.

For starters, men believe that they have a reputation to uphold with their workmates, their friends, with strangers and with you. It is all about their status. In other words, if a man's status drops in society, he will be seen as weak and vulnerable. Therefore, instead of admitting that they are weak by being honest, they choose to lie to hide their shortcomings and weaknesses instead.

Another reason why men lie is because they want to steer clear of confrontations as much as possible. Unfortunately, these will always come up in a relationship and will almost always result in massive misunderstandings. Your man might choose to have drinks after work, for example, and then lie to you about it by saying that he was finishing reports for work. The reason why he would lie, though, is to simply avoid a potential argument that may have come up if he came home late because he was drinking.

Unfortunately, most women who find out that their significant other lied about something work-related will immediately think that the men lied because they were cheating on them, not because they were out drinking. This issue could then get much worse because of this. This isn't a good excuse or anything. In fact, this could be one of the most stupid reasons to lie. However, it is a very common reason for men's lies and is also a very common reason for conflict to arise in the end.

Now, if your husband tends to lie constantly, then the best way to deal with his lies would be to simply confront him and ask him why he did it. Then, tell him what bothers you about the lies. Then, let him know that you no longer trust him completely because he lied. This simple threat is usually enough to make liars put things in focus, reevaluate why men lie in the first place and change their ways. Try it.

Broken trust causes a majority of divorces. But you don't have to end your marriage because of this! Marriages are made up of many things - trust, although a HUGE part, is only one of them. It doesn't matter if you are the one who broke this special bond, or if you are the victim. What matters is that you need help.

When you are the person that broke the trust

While there are many ways trust is broken, the main one is infidelity. If you have cheated on your spouse, you are here because you know that you made a horrible mistake. You want to change things, and save your marriage. Have you opened up to your spouse yet? Have you told them that you've made a horrible mistake, and you are sorry? Have you told your spouse that you want to try to save the marriage, and that you are willing to do whatever it takes to do so?

You have to show your spouse that you want to make things better. This is going to take time, work, and commitment. Trust isn't something that comes easy to begin with, and it will take time to gain back. but you CAN do it, and when you succeed, your marriage will be all the more stable!

When you are the victim of broken trust

What if you find yourself on the opposite end of broken trust? What if YOU are the one that was cheated on? This is devastating, to say the least. The most important thing you can do right now is to learn to forgive. You will never forget what happened, but by forgiving your partner, you will release the pent up anger and resentment that is building up inside of you, and eating away at you.

You must forgive your spouse. Not only to save your marriage, but to help yourself. Your spouse has a lot of work ahead of them. Hopefully, you have forgiven them. A mistake was made. Talk to your spouse. Find out why they think the affair happened. Is it because the romance has gone out of your marriage? Is it because the love is fading?

If so, there are things you can do right now to make your spouse feel loved. Also, by opening up the lines of communication in your marriage, you will feel more loved, yourself. Your marriage, over time, will become stronger. Many couples who are faced with this situation come out stronger than ever, because they work together to save their marriage.

Even though divorce rates are higher than they've ever been, not everyone who heads for divorce court really wants to dissolve their union. In fact, if there were alternatives, a large number of the couples who actually go through with it would probably have chosen a different option. A temporary separation is often enough to show the partners just how difficult and painful it is to live apart, and many long to return to the relative security of their relationships even if there are issues. So what can they change that will help them resurrect their marriage and live long, happy lives together?

Sometimes the best course of action involves knowing exactly what you shouldn't do. There are some behaviors that are almost guaranteed to drive the wedge between your spouse and yourself even deeper. One of the futile attempts that many people try to make is in attempting to reassure their spouse verbally that they have changed and that things are going to be different. Unfortunately, words often carry little weight and can only serve to make you look insincere and pathetic. Your spouse wants to see ways in which you've changed, not just hear about them. If you show confidence as you go about trying to right some of the wrongs in your relationship, your spouse is going to respond in a more positive manner.

Strange as it may seem, a couple in the midst of an emotional upheaval should not use the words "I love you", because it isn't going to help do anything but push you and your spouse farther apart. We've all been raised to think of those words as the cure-all for our problems; however, they are not. Instead, they strike at the most sensitive emotional areas within you at a time when they are raw and bleeding. Your spouse doesn't want to feel guilty or emotionally assaulted during this time, even if the words should be comforting. Instead, show your spouse how much you care by your actions, and as time passes and you both heal, you'll be able to express your feelings in words once again.

All of us have self-defense techniques built into our personalities, but if you're trying to win back your spouse, this isn't the time to use them. A common reaction to stress is to try and explain your own behaviors and to put down those of your partner. Neither guilt or logic is going to sway your spouse in any positive way. In fact, those are exactly the tools you need to use if you want to sever your relationship permanently. This is not a competition, and you shouldn't be trying to win anything. Once again, it's going to take time, patience, and a positive outlook to reconstruct your marriage, but it will definitely be worth the effort if you succeed.

How to stop the divorce after one spouse has filed is what most people are interested in knowing. Some people are confused and depressed when their spouse starts the divorce process to end their marriage. If you want to make it easier for you to stop the divorce proceedings, you must act quickly before it is too late. A lot of people make what we usually call common mistakes when trying to stop the divorce after one spouse have filed. As soon as the divorce is filed, they naturally start reacting in certain ways that prevents genuine reconciliation. If you want to know how to stop your divorce and save your marriage, you must be willing to invest in yourself. You must be willing to educate.

You must be aware right away that you do not have any legal right to stop your spouse from divorcing you. However, there are things you can do to delay the divorce process, if your spouse wants a divorce. The only way you can stop the divorce after a filing has been done is to persuade your spouse that divorce is not the best answer. If your spouse agrees the two of you should fix the marriage, the divorce proceedings can be easily stopped. If you can motivate your spouse to consider how much better of it will be when you both fix the marriage, you may be able to stop the divorce.

There are certain things you may need to do and follow in order to make your spouse to stop the divorce process. Some of these things include:

Be honest with your spouse. This is one of the critical things you need to do if you want to stop the divorce after one spouse has filed. Repent from every known sin. This is the first thing to do. If your spouse wants divorce because of some acts of infidelity or cheating on your part, this is the time to show that you are truly sorry and will never mess up again. Let your spouse know without doubt that you are a changed person, old things have passed away.

Accepting the issues in your marriage. There is no doubt that your spouse is filing for divorce for a number of reasons. You must accept the issues, identify them and agree to deal with them in a healthy and positive manner. Let your spouse see that you are already making the best efforts to fix the issues with the marriage for good.

Commitment. Are you committed to the success of the marriage? Commitment is complete loyalty to your spouse. Show your spouse that you are committed to his/her welfare, well-being and happiness. If you find that you are more committed to your job, business, friends and other family members than your partner, you must quickly retrace your steps.

Show maturity. A mature person is emotionally, spiritually and mentally developed enough to handle circumstances and deal wisely with the issues of life. If your spouse should file for divorce, there is no doubt that you were unable to deal with the many issues in your marriage. Show maturity by calmly taking time to deal with every unresolved issue in the marriage. Provide a relaxed, calm environment where both of you can discuss and fix the marriage.

Seek out help. Consider seeking out those who have successfully built a long lasting and happy marriage, since they may be empathetic and helpful to you. Their genuine love and advice will help you to handle the issues in your marriage. You can change your associates and even go for counseling as a demonstration of your strong desire for change.

Once your spouse has agreed to remain in the marriage, you should encourage her to seek out legal help to stop the divorce proceedings. This must be done quickly before the judgment is finalized.
